Nevertheless, it was Mrs. Truex who was forever recognized in restaurants and shops as Mrs. George Wilson The actress also appeared in several motion pictures, starting with one silent, The Exalted Flapper, and a new-fangled talkie, Voice of the City, both in 1929. After the end of Mr. Peepers, Field continued to guest star on episodic television, including in roles on Producers' Showcase, Star Tonight, General Electric Theater, and The Ann Sothern Show. Sylvia Field (born Harriet Louisa Johnson; February 14, 1901 - July 31, 1998) was an American actress whose career encompassed performances on stage, screen, and TV. It's no one's fault. Hang the looks at the thing! The show, which aired until 1955, co-starred Field's real-life husband Ernest Truex. Field continued in television guest spots during the 1960s, including on the ABC sitcoms Our Man Higgins with Stanley Holloway and Hazel.
